Thiem creates a surprise, Mayer deserves credit

Latest News

The semi-finals, pitting the younger generation against the older players, lived up to all expectations today on the central court of the Nice Lawn Tennis Club, delivering surprises, suspense, and outbursts to the great delight of the audience.


In the early afternoon, the ground shook when young Dominic Thiem, the hero of the day, managed to topple the American giant who was better ranked and extremely competitive this week.

The determined and focused Austrian displayed solid tennis, dragging John Isner into longer rallies that he dislikes, forcing him to play one more shot. This tactical maturity allowed him to reach an ATP circuit final for the second time in his career at just 21 years old.

On the other side of the draw, the young prodigy Borna Coric was expected for a 100% “teenager” final, but the No. 4 seed Leonardo Mayer had other plans…
Always very aggressive from the first points, the Argentine quickly took control of the court despite the Croatian’s efforts to push his opponent far from the baseline.

Coric, naturally very tenacious, did not give up in the second set, creating 9 break points that unfortunately he could not convert against Mayer’s experience.

An explosive final

For the last day of the Nice Côte d’Azur Open, the Nice audience will have the chance to witness an explosive final between a young ambitious player seeking his first title against a surface specialist not inclined to be dominated in his third circuit final.

The doubles final, always very spectacular, will precede this highly anticipated duel.
